Your choices and rights

Depending on location, you may have rights to access, know, correct, delete, restrict or object to processing, receive portable data, withdraw consent, opt out of certain sale/sharing/targeted-advertising uses, appeal a refusal, and complain to a regulator. We will verify identity proportionately and may request authorised-agent documentation. We will not discriminate against you for exercising a right.

Regional contacts

EEA users may complain to the Irish Data Protection Commission or their local supervisory authority. UK users may complain to the Information Commissioner's Office. Canadian users may contact the Office of the Privacy Commissioner of Canada or an applicable provincial regulator. Australian users may contact the Australian Information Commissioner after first giving Vmemoo a reasonable opportunity to respond. New Zealand users may contact the Office of the Privacy Commissioner. US residents may contact the relevant state attorney general or privacy regulator where applicable.
